Sunday, February 15, 2009

Finding the Maximum and The Maximum Number

#include<stdio.h>

main()
{
    int arr[5];
    int max=0;
    int min;

    printf("Enter 5 Numbers : ");
    for(int i=0;i<5;i++)
    {
        scanf("%d",&arr[i]);
        fflush(stdin);
        max=arr[i];
        if(arr[i]<min)
        {
            min=arr[i];
        }

    }

    printf("MAX is : %d",max);
    printf("\nMIN is : %d",min);

}

Saturday, February 14, 2009

Search for a Character

#include<stdio.h>

main()
{

    char str[25];
    char search;
    int count=0;

        printf("Enter a String : ");
        fflush(stdin);
        gets(str);

        printf("Enter a Word to Search : ");
        scanf("%c",&search);

        for(int i=0;i<25;i++)
        {
            if(str[i]==search)
            {
                count++;
            }
        }

        printf("That Characther Found %d Time(s)",count);
}

Reversing a Word

image

 

#include<stdio.h>

main()
{
    char str[15];
    char rev_str[15];

    printf("Enter a String : ");
    fflush(stdin);
    gets(str);

    for(int i=0;str[i]!='\0';i++)
        {

        }

    for(str[i]='\0';i>=0;i--)
        {
            rev_str[i]=str[i];
            printf("%c",rev_str[i]);
        }

}

Count Letters in a Sentence

#include<stdio.h>

main()
{

char str[15];
int space_count=0;
int count=0;
int final;

printf("Enter a String : ");
fflush(stdin);
gets(str);

for(int i=0;str[i]!='\0';i++)
{

    count++;
  if(str[i]==' ')
    {
            space_count++;

        }

}

        final=(count-space_count);
        printf("\n\nNumber of Letters  : %d",final);

}

Wednesday, February 11, 2009

Compare two Strings

//Compare two Strings :)

# include
# include

main()
{
char arr1[5];
char arr2[5];

printf("\nEnter the First String : ");
gets(arr1);
fflush(stdin);

printf("\nEnter the Second String : ");
gets(arr2);
fflush(stdin);

if((strcmp(arr1,arr2)==0))
{
printf("\n Strings are Equal");
}
else
{
printf("\nStrings are Not Equal");
}


}

Adding Numbers in Arrys

# include

main()
{

int a[5]={1,2,3,4,5};
int b[5]={1,2,3,4,5};
int c[5];

for(int i=0;i<5;i++)
{
c[i]=a[i]+b[i];
printf("%d\n",c[i]);
}




}

Tuesday, February 10, 2009

Passing a Array to a Function

#include

int addNumbers(int fiveNumbers[]); /* declare function */

int main() {
int array[5];
int i;

printf("Enter 5 integers separated by spaces: ");

for(i=0 ; i<5 ; i++) {
scanf("%d", &array[i]);
}

printf("\nTheir sum is: %d\n", addNumbers(array));
return 0;
}

int addNumbers(int fiveNumbers[]) { /* define function */
int sum = 0;
int i;

for(i=0 ; i<5 ; i++) {
sum+=fiveNumbers[i]; /* work out the total */
}
return sum; /* return the total */
}